Bug 73480

Summary: [MutationObservers] Need layout tests asserting that non-event async callbacks deliver mutations after completion
Product: WebKit Reporter: Rafael Weinstein <rafaelw>
Component: DOMAssignee: Rafael Weinstein <rafaelw>
Status: RESOLVED FIXED    
Severity: Normal CC: adamk, ojan, rniwa, sam, webkit.review.bot
Priority: P2    
Version: 528+ (Nightly build)   
Hardware: Unspecified   
OS: Unspecified   
Bug Depends on:    
Bug Blocks: 68729    
Attachments:
Description Flags
Patch none

Description Rafael Weinstein 2011-11-30 12:40:05 PST
I'm not sure how to test non-event sync callbacks (e.g. for namespace resolution or node filtering), but we should add layout tests for Database, Filesystem at least.
Comment 1 Ryosuke Niwa 2011-11-30 12:51:11 PST
Do you mean sync or async?
Comment 2 Rafael Weinstein 2011-11-30 13:01:28 PST
I meant what I said and I said what I meant.... You know the rest =-).
Comment 3 Rafael Weinstein 2011-11-30 13:06:11 PST
Created attachment 117259 [details]
Patch
Comment 4 Ryosuke Niwa 2011-11-30 15:18:14 PST
(In reply to comment #1)
> Do you mean sync or async?

The bug summary says non-event async callbacks but you seem to be talking about sync callbacks.
Comment 5 Ryosuke Niwa 2011-11-30 15:21:55 PST
Ah, I now I understand what you're saying.
Comment 6 WebKit Review Bot 2011-11-30 21:42:44 PST
Comment on attachment 117259 [details]
Patch

Clearing flags on attachment: 117259

Committed r101605: <http://trac.webkit.org/changeset/101605>
Comment 7 WebKit Review Bot 2011-11-30 21:42:49 PST
All reviewed patches have been landed.  Closing bug.